Etymology of the name: roots and original meaning

The name Noboru is of Japanese origin and carries a rich history and deep cultural significance. In Japanese, Noboru (昇) means “rise” or “ascend,” reflecting qualities of ambition, progress, and growth. The name is derived from the verb “noboru,” which signifies moving upwards or reaching new heights.
